Understanding the Cause of the Odor

One of the first steps in combat helmet odor elimination is understanding the cause of the odor. Perspiration is the most common culprit, as sweat tends to accumulate in the padding and foam of the helmet, creating an ideal breeding ground for bacteria. Over time, this buildup leads to a noticeable, unpleasant smell. The smell can also be caused by exposure to smoke, chemicals, or other environmental factors. By understanding the underlying cause of the odor, you can better prepare to effectively eliminate it. How to Properly Apply Odor Eliminator to Combat Helmet

To effectively eliminate the odor from your combat helmet, it's important to properly apply the odor eliminator spray - Arrest My Vest. Begin by removing the helmet's padding and foam inserts, if possible. This will allow for better ventilation and ensure that the odor eliminator reaches all parts of the helmet.

Next, shake the odor eliminator spray well and hold it approximately six inches away from the helmet. Spray the solution in a sweeping motion, making sure to cover all surfaces of the helmet. Pay special attention to the areas where sweat tends to accumulate, such as the forehead and temples.

After applying the odor eliminator spray, allow the helmet to air dry completely before reinserting the padding and foam inserts. This will ensure that the helmet is thoroughly treated and eliminate any chance of lingering odors.

With these proper application techniques, your combat helmet will be smelling fresh and clean in no time

Additional Tips for Maintaining a Fresh-Smelling Combat Helmet

To maintain a fresh-smelling combat helmet, there are a few additional tips that you can follow. First, make sure to air out your helmet after each use by removing the padding and foam inserts and leaving them out in a well-ventilated area. This will help prevent moisture buildup and decrease the chance of odors developing.

Consider investing in a helmet bag or storage case to protect your helmet when it is not in use. This can help prevent the accumulation of dust, dirt, and odors that can develop over time.

By following these additional tips for maintaining a fresh-smelling combat helmet, you can ensure that your helmet stays clean, comfortable, and odor-free for long-lasting use.
